'Voodoo Ash Trick'


Alritey! Here we go with a pretty sweet street magic trick. This trick is especially fun to do around anyone who smokes or at a family BBQ; you will understand why in a bit. In this trick, you will need to know how to do the 'glide force' ,which we already learned earlier, or any other kind of card forcing technique. Once again, I am going to use the glide force in the explanation because it is one of the easiest forces to do. You will also need to write on your arm with chap stick. Why you ask? Once again you will find out in a bit.

What is this trick?: The voodoo ash trick is a trick that gives the spectator a very eerie feeling after it has been done. It is not like any other card trick that we have done so far. I would definitely leave this trick to the last if you are doing a routine on the streets or where ever.

Performance: The magician has a spectator choose a card and place it back in the deck. He then hands the spectator a piece of paper and pen and tells them to write what their card was on it than to fold it. The magician than asks if he can borrow a lighter from someone and begins to set it on fire. The paper burns up and he takes the the ashes and rubs them on his forearm. When he removes his hand, the ashes from the paper have written their chosen card on his arm.

Let me tell you something, this trick honestly does have a sick ending and you will find that some people will actually believe that some kind of voodoo was used. But since voodoo obviously wasn't used, how was this trick really done? The answer is simple, chap stick.

Setup: Before you do this trick, you need to write the name of the card that you are going to force on your spectator onto your arm with chap stick. The ashes will than stick only onto the chap stick writing which makes it seem like some sort of voodoo was used.

So when doing this trick, make sure you force the right card that is on your arm, otherwise you will look like a moron. You can do this trick anywhere really.
